When embarking on a WordPress project, determining developer rates is crucial. Considerations impacting cost entail complexity, experience level, project scope, and location. Junior developers often charge lower rates than expert developers with extensive portfolios and proven track records.
Fixed-price pricing models are common in the WordPress development world. Time-based fees can range $50 to $200, while project costs for simple sites might start at several thousand dollars.
For sophisticated projects involving custom features, expect to pay a substantially greater price. Remember to acquire detailed estimates from developers, outlining their experience, timeline, and payment terms.

Building the Right WordPress Developer: Budget & Skills
Securing a skilled WordPress developer can be crucial for your website's success. However, navigating the market and determining the right fit can feel overwhelming. Balancing budget constraints with essential skills is a key factor.
First, outline your project scope. This will help you determine the level of expertise required. A simple blog may only require basic skills, while a complex e-commerce site necessitates advanced functionality and security.
Next, define your budget. WordPress developers differ in price based on experience, location, and project complexity. Remember to include ongoing maintenance costs too.
It's crucial to investigate potential developers thoroughly. Check portfolios, read testimonials, and request referrals.
Clear communication is fundamental throughout the process. Explain your vision, expectations, and timeline with potential developers to ensure a seamless collaboration.
Finally, don't be afraid to interview multiple candidates before making a decision. This allows you to compare their skills, experience, and communication styles.

The Cost of a WordPress Plugin
When it comes to improving your WordPress site's functionality, plugins are an invaluable tool. But how much do these versatile tools actually cost? The fact is that WordPress plugin prices differ greatly, from completely costless options to premium solutions that can cost a considerable sum.
- No-cost plugins are often a fantastic initial option, offering basic features without any financial expense. These plugins are powered by a community of passionate developers.
- Pro plugins, on the other hand, usually offer more sophisticated features, along with customer service from the developer. Their price can vary depending on elements like the plugin's complexity, usage, and the level of help included.
Therefore, the optimal way to determine the right price for a WordPress plugin is to carefully consider your goals. Investigate different options, read testimonials, and compare features and pricing to find the ideal plugin for your site.
